3 Facts you need to know about Landscaping!

Who doesn’t love a landscaped place? Of course, everyone does, as people love to be surrounded by lush green grass and beautiful plants. The environment protection institutes and regulatory bodies also recommend people to grow plants in their homes. More on, the landscaping in public places also seems mandatory and the government pays attention to […]

Begin typing your search term above and press enter to search. Press ESC to cancel.

Back To Top